Job Summary

The Shopgoodwill Product Specialist works inside the retail store location and assists the store management team in reaching the operational goals of the site by identifying, selecting, and forwarding high-value items to our eCommerce facility to support the growth of Goodwill’s online sales.  This role will also function in various capacities within the store location when needed. 

Example Duties and Activities

  • Searches incoming donations for high-value merchandise.

  • Processes and organizes products for eCommerce and in-store showcases.

  • Completes all required training to assist the site in achieving online sales goals.

  • Maximizes online posting percentage while maintaining a high average ticket. 

  • Maintains clean and orderly work area.  

  • Hits financial goal/budget.
